TOKYO -- Costco Wholesale Japan and household products maker Kao have started using crates that serve as both shipping containers and product display shelves, combating Japan's labor shortage while cutting their environmental impact.
Store chain and household goods maker fight labor shortage, reduce waste

The reusable containers, which replace cardboard boxes, can be displayed as they are and reduce restocking time by 20%. (Photo courtesy of Kao)
